Benefits of Mobile Apps for Religious Communities

  • Enhanced Communication: Instant updates about services, events, and announcements.
  • Community Engagement: Features like prayer requests, discussion forums, and volunteer sign-ups foster active participation.
  • Resource Sharing: Access to sermons, podcasts, scriptures, and educational materials anytime, anywhere.
  • Event Management: Simplifies registration, reminders, and feedback collection for events and programs.

Key Features to Include in Your App

  • Daily Devotions and Scripture: Provide daily spiritual content to encourage regular engagement.
  • Event Calendar: Display upcoming services, classes, and community events.
  • Push Notifications: Send timely alerts about important updates or emergencies.
  • Donation Portal: Facilitate tithes and donations securely through the app.
  • Interactive Features: Prayer walls, discussion forums, and Q&A sections to foster community interaction.

Steps to Develop Your Religious Community App

Creating an effective mobile app involves careful planning and execution. Here are the key steps:

  • Identify Your Goals: Determine what features will best serve your community's needs.
  • Choose a Development Approach: Decide between hiring developers or using app builder platforms.
  • Design User-Friendly Interfaces: Prioritize simplicity and accessibility for all age groups.
  • Develop and Test: Build the app with ongoing testing to ensure functionality and usability.
  • Launch and Promote: Introduce the app to your community through announcements and training sessions.
  • Gather Feedback: Continuously improve the app based on user input and changing needs.
